  • What does "buy" mean in VWESQ activity?

    "Buy" means an investor increased their reported position in VWESQ compared to the prior reporting period. This reflects growing exposure to VWESQ rather than necessarily a brand-new position (though new positions also appear as buys when prior quantity was zero).
